Find a fresh take on off-campus student living at Atlas on 17th in Bloomington, Indiana. Embark on your next chapter at our boutique apartment community in Monroe County, where you’ll be just minutes from Indiana University Bloomington. When you’re not hitting the books, you can hang out in style at one of our vibrant amenity spaces or just kick back and relax in your cozy one, two, three, or four bedroom home.     Atlas on 17th just introduced a new guest parking policy that is incredibly frustrating. For a large apartment complex, they only offer 20 guest passes total, and residents have to physically go to the office, fill out a form, and check one out themselves. The passes only last 48 hours, and if they aren’t returned in time, there’s a $25 fee. Honestly, I would have recommended this place to friends, but policies like this make it really hard to justify. It shouldn’t be this complicated just to have friends or family visit. For what residents pay to live here, this feels like a poor solution to their parking issues. Hopefully, management can come up with something that actually works for residents.
